Ilsington Country House Hotel and Spa

AA Silver award for comfort, 2 AA Rosettes for food and multiple awards for the Spa make Ilsington the perfect destination for rest and relaxation. Family owned and run and set in 11 acres of private land within the boundaries of the Dartmoor National Park and within sight of Haytor Rocks. A choice of two dining options either in the main Restaurant or the Blue Tiger Inn with its large sun terrace and offering more informal dishes of excellent quality - served all day. Emphasis is on local produce and homemade creations. Lovely cream teas can be enjoyed in one of the comfortable lounges during the afternoon and a traditional Sunday Lunch each week. Beautiful luxury Spa opened in 2015 with hydrotherapy pool, sauna, steam room, fitness suite and indoor pool. Achieved Gold for Spa and Wellness Experience in South West Tourism's 2017 awards and Gold in VisitDevon Spa Awards for 2015, 2017 & 2019. Three treatment rooms also available offering a range of luxury treatments. Located in the Dartmoor National Park, yet only 4 miles from the A38 making Ilsington and ideal place for exploring South Devon. Included in the Good Hotel Guide.

Dilkhusa Grand Hotel

Situated on the level seafront of this hugely popular Victorian seaside resort stands the welcoming Dilkhusa Grand Hotel. The hotel was originally a private house, bought by a Raj at the turn of the last century as a gift to his wife - Dilkhusa translates from Hindustani roughly as ‘House of the Happy Heart!’ The hotel overlooks the picturesque Runnymede gardens and is close to the Landmark theatre which attracts many national acts. It is also just a short walk from the bustling 10th-century harbour where Britain’s most famous living artist, Damien Hirst, owns a restaurant. The Dilkhusa has a well-appointed restaurant combining excellent hospitality and service. A spacious and comfortable entertainments suite provides the ideal setting in which to sit back and enjoy the acts at this friendly and sociable hotel...
